imtokenContract Interaction Management of imToken Wallet: A Future Where Blockchain Asset Security and Efficient Management Coexist

What is the fee calculation method of the imToken wallet: Revealing the logic and practice behind it

Updated on 2025-06-12

With the rapid development of blockchain technology, the demand for digital asset management is gradually increasing. As a widely popular digital asset management tool, the fee calculation method of the imToken wallet has attracted the attention of many users. This article will delve into the fee calculation mechanism of the imToken wallet to answer related questions for users.

I. Overview of imToken Wallet

imToken is a secure and user-friendly digital asset wallet that provides users with storage and management functions for various virtual currencies, including Bitcoin, Ethereum, and ERC-20 tokens. When users conduct transactions with imToken, various types of fees may be incurred. Understanding the principles behind the calculation of these fees is crucial for users to optimize their operations and control costs.

1.1 imToken钱包的特点

  • SecurityimToken uses multi-layer encryption technology to ensure the security of users' assets.
  • Easy to useThe user interface is friendly, the operation is smooth, and it is easy for beginners to get started.
  • Multi-currency supportimToken supports a wide range of mainstream and niche cryptocurrencies, making it convenient for users to diversify their investments.
  • 1.2 Usage Scenarios

    Users can perform asset management, trading, transfers, and purchase digital currencies on imToken, and these activities may involve various forms of fees.

    What is the fee calculation method of the imToken wallet: Revealing the logic and practice behind it

    2. Types of Fees in imToken Wallet

    In the imToken wallet, users encounter different types of fees when making transactions, mainly including the following:

    2.1 Network Fees (Gas Fees)

    On blockchain platforms such as Ethereum, users are required to pay network fees, also known as gas fees, when conducting transactions. The calculation of these fees mainly depends on the following factors:

  • 交易复杂度The computational complexity of different transactions varies, and the execution of complex contracts will consume more gas.
  • 网络拥堵情况When the network is busy, gas prices usually increase, and users need to pay higher fees to ensure their transactions are processed in a timely manner.
  • 2.2 Exchange Fees

    When users exchange tokens using imToken, the platform charges a certain exchange fee. This fee is mainly used to maintain the operation and liquidity of the exchange.

    2.3 Withdrawal Fees

    If users transfer funds from the imToken wallet to another wallet or exchange, a withdrawal fee is usually incurred. The withdrawal fee varies depending on the amount withdrawn and the target network, and different networks have different fees.

    3. Methods of Cost Calculation

    The calculation of fees can be divided into several steps, and understanding these steps helps users make more informed decisions when conducting transactions.

    3.1 Calculation of Network Fees

    In imToken, network fees are mainly calculated using the following formula:

    \[ \text{Total Cost} = \text{Gas Price} \times \text{Gas Consumption} \]

  • Gas priceUsers can choose an appropriate gas price based on network conditions. It is generally recommended to use a lower gas price during off-peak network hours to save on fees.
  • Gas consumptionThe amount of Gas consumed by each transaction is determined by the complexity of the smart contract, and users can view the estimated consumption before confirming the transaction.
  • 3.2 Calculation of Exchange Fees

    When exchanging currencies, the following formula can be used:

    \[ \text{Exchange Fee} = \text{Exchange Amount} \times \text{Service Charge Rate} \]

    For example, if a user exchanges 1,000 USDT with a fee rate of 0.1%, the exchange fee would be 1 USDT.

    3.3 Calculation of Withdrawal Fees

    Withdrawal fees are usually either fixed or charged as a percentage. Users can view the specific fees on the withdrawal page in imToken. Generally, the withdrawal fee is closely related to the selected withdrawal currency and the target platform.

    4. How to Reduce Expenses

    To reduce fees when using the imToken wallet, users can adopt the following strategies:

    4.1 Choosing the Appropriate Trading Time

    Conducting transactions during network off-peak hours can effectively reduce gas prices. Users can use some blockchain network monitoring tools to determine the most suitable time for transactions.

    4.2 Controlling Transaction Volume

    Large transactions will incur higher transaction fees. Users may consider splitting their transactions into multiple batches to reduce the cost of each individual transaction.

    4.3 Taking Advantage of No-Fee Promotions

    On certain trading platforms or during specific periods, imToken may launch fee-free promotions. Users should pay close attention to these opportunities to save on transaction costs.

    5. User Case Analysis

    To help users better understand imToken's fee calculation, here is an analysis using a real-life example.

    5.1 Case One: Small Amount Transfer

    User A transfers 0.5 ETH to User B. The current gas price is 50 Gwei, and the estimated consumption is 21,000 Gas.

  • Network fee
  • \[

    Cost = 50 × 21000 = 1,050,000 Gwei ≈ 0.00105 ETH

    \]

    If the user chooses to make a transfer during periods of network congestion, the gas price may reach 100 Gwei, increasing the fee to 0.0021 ETH.

    5.2 Case Study 2: Currency Exchange

    User C exchanges 500 USDT for BTC, with a transaction fee of 0.1%. At this point, the fee is calculated as follows:

  • Exchange fee
  • \[

    \text{Cost} = 500 \times 0.001 = 0.5 \, \text{USDT}

    \]

    If the same operation is performed on other platforms, the fees may be higher, so choosing imToken for the exchange demonstrates its cost-effectiveness.

    VI. Frequently Asked Questions

    Question 1: What are the fees associated with the imToken wallet?

    The imToken wallet mainly includes network fees, exchange fees, and withdrawal fees, which are reflected during the user's usage.

    Question 2: How can I check transaction fees?

    When making a transaction, imToken provides a fee estimation feature, allowing users to view the estimated fees before confirming the transaction.

    Question 3: Can the handling fee be modified?

    Users can manually adjust the gas price based on network conditions to influence the transaction fee.

    Question 4: Which cryptocurrencies does the imToken wallet support for transactions?

    imToken wallet supports a variety of mainstream cryptocurrencies, such as Bitcoin, Ethereum, and its ERC-20 tokens, allowing users to trade between multiple currencies.

    Question 5: Is it possible to set the fee to zero?

    In most cases, users cannot set network fees to zero, as they are related to the transaction processing efficiency of the blockchain.

    Summary

    The fee calculation method of the imToken wallet helps users understand the various fees that may be incurred during transactions, exchanges, and withdrawals. By understanding the fee structure and calculation formulas, users can better control costs, make reasonable financial management decisions, and thus enjoy a higher-quality digital asset management experience.